Paul Nixon is the sole advisor at Quillpen Advisors, LLC, an independent firm based in Bee Cave, TX. He holds a Series 65 credential and has five years of experience in financial advising. Prior to founding Quillpen Advisors in 2020, Nixon worked at NXP Semiconductors and has operated Nixon Technology Consulting since 2017. Outside of advisory work, he serves on the board of a quantum photonics cybersecurity startup and is involved with a family publishing LLC. Quillpen Advisors serves individual clients, offering portfolio management and financial planning services with a small client roster and approximately $12.8 million in assets under management. The firm emphasizes direct access to its managing member and leverages Nixon’s extensive technology and executive background.
